summaryrefslogtreecommitdiffstats
path: root/src/usr/diag
diff options
context:
space:
mode:
authorBill Schwartz <whs@us.ibm.com>2014-02-05 18:32:45 -0600
committerA. Patrick Williams III <iawillia@us.ibm.com>2014-02-12 17:50:50 -0600
commite493d67545aa1bcb1ef5418212609aea8ddc9f9b (patch)
treeb05c92e77d09c339e4dd33d5312df56c59d853cb /src/usr/diag
parent619e886b4f46478b447bff9789f0a47986cb78e4 (diff)
downloadtalos-hostboot-e493d67545aa1bcb1ef5418212609aea8ddc9f9b.tar.gz
talos-hostboot-e493d67545aa1bcb1ef5418212609aea8ddc9f9b.zip
Cleanup enum MNFG_FLAG_BIT_MNFG_IPL_MEMORY_CE_CHECKINGE
There are 3 steps. This is step 1. Step 1: "Add" typo fix for CHECKING and "Add" shorter enumeration names without the redundant "BIT_MNFG_" to common targeting files. Fix host boot only files. Once common targeting files are in FSP build... Step 2a: Update FSP side including prd common file Step 2b: Remove CHECKINGE typo and long enumeration names from common targeting files. Fix up common prd host boot file Change-Id: I3619a2389d421026b5bf3dd0df53113ee7d9a034 RTC: 89378 Reviewed-on: http://gfw160.aus.stglabs.ibm.com:8080/gerrit/8593 Tested-by: Jenkins Server Reviewed-by: A. Patrick Williams III <iawillia@us.ibm.com>
Diffstat (limited to 'src/usr/diag')
-rw-r--r--src/usr/diag/mdia/mdia.C2
-rw-r--r--src/usr/diag/mdia/mdiamba.C8
-rw-r--r--src/usr/diag/mdia/mdiasm.C2
-rwxr-xr-xsrc/usr/diag/prdf/common/framework/service/prdfTargetServices.C2
-rwxr-xr-xsrc/usr/diag/prdf/common/framework/service/prdfTargetServices.H4
5 files changed, 10 insertions, 8 deletions
diff --git a/src/usr/diag/mdia/mdia.C b/src/usr/diag/mdia/mdia.C
index aea2bce05..66a92a7fe 100644
--- a/src/usr/diag/mdia/mdia.C
+++ b/src/usr/diag/mdia/mdia.C
@@ -71,7 +71,7 @@ errlHndl_t runStep(const TargetHandleList & i_targetList)
if(maxMemPatterns)
{
globals.mfgPolicy |=
- MNFG_FLAG_BIT_MNFG_ENABLE_EXHAUSTIVE_PATTERN_TEST;
+ MNFG_FLAG_ENABLE_EXHAUSTIVE_PATTERN_TEST;
}
globals.simicsRunning = Util::isSimicsRunning();
diff --git a/src/usr/diag/mdia/mdiamba.C b/src/usr/diag/mdia/mdiamba.C
index ebb4587e5..1b73d54f8 100644
--- a/src/usr/diag/mdia/mdiamba.C
+++ b/src/usr/diag/mdia/mdiamba.C
@@ -50,19 +50,19 @@ errlHndl_t getMbaDiagnosticMode(
o_mode = ONE_PATTERN;
}
- else if(MNFG_FLAG_BIT_MNFG_ENABLE_EXHAUSTIVE_PATTERN_TEST
+ else if(MNFG_FLAG_ENABLE_EXHAUSTIVE_PATTERN_TEST
& i_globals.mfgPolicy)
{
o_mode = NINE_PATTERNS;
}
- else if(MNFG_FLAG_BIT_MNFG_ENABLE_STANDARD_PATTERN_TEST
+ else if(MNFG_FLAG_ENABLE_STANDARD_PATTERN_TEST
& i_globals.mfgPolicy)
{
o_mode = FOUR_PATTERNS;
}
- else if(MNFG_FLAG_BIT_MNFG_ENABLE_MINIMUM_PATTERN_TEST
+ else if(MNFG_FLAG_ENABLE_MINIMUM_PATTERN_TEST
& i_globals.mfgPolicy)
{
o_mode = ONE_PATTERN;
@@ -138,7 +138,7 @@ errlHndl_t getMbaWorkFlow(
break;
}
- if(MNFG_FLAG_BIT_MNFG_IPL_MEMORY_CE_CHECKINGE
+ if(MNFG_FLAG_IPL_MEMORY_CE_CHECKING
& i_globals.mfgPolicy)
{
o_wf.push_back(ANALYZE_IPL_MNFG_CE_STATS);
diff --git a/src/usr/diag/mdia/mdiasm.C b/src/usr/diag/mdia/mdiasm.C
index a140c2561..f62d3f566 100644
--- a/src/usr/diag/mdia/mdiasm.C
+++ b/src/usr/diag/mdia/mdiasm.C
@@ -778,7 +778,7 @@ errlHndl_t StateMachine::doMaintCommand(WorkFlowProperties & i_wfp)
break;
}
- if( TARGETING::MNFG_FLAG_BIT_MNFG_IPL_MEMORY_CE_CHECKINGE & mfgPolicy )
+ if( TARGETING::MNFG_FLAG_IPL_MEMORY_CE_CHECKING & mfgPolicy )
{
// For MNFG mode, check CE also
stopCondition |= mss_MaintCmd::STOP_ON_HARD_NCE_ETE;
diff --git a/src/usr/diag/prdf/common/framework/service/prdfTargetServices.C b/src/usr/diag/prdf/common/framework/service/prdfTargetServices.C
index 24ef31040..099634f0c 100755
--- a/src/usr/diag/prdf/common/framework/service/prdfTargetServices.C
+++ b/src/usr/diag/prdf/common/framework/service/prdfTargetServices.C
@@ -1380,6 +1380,8 @@ bool isMnfgFlagSet( uint32_t i_flag )
//------------------------------------------------------------------------------
+// TODO: RTC 89378 remove "BIT_MNFG" and remove E from "CHECKING" once
+// the attribute_types update is in the fsp build
bool mfgMode()
{ return isMnfgFlagSet( MNFG_FLAG_BIT_MNFG_THRESHOLDS ); }
diff --git a/src/usr/diag/prdf/common/framework/service/prdfTargetServices.H b/src/usr/diag/prdf/common/framework/service/prdfTargetServices.H
index 2bcbda38d..b16a21cf5 100755
--- a/src/usr/diag/prdf/common/framework/service/prdfTargetServices.H
+++ b/src/usr/diag/prdf/common/framework/service/prdfTargetServices.H
@@ -438,8 +438,8 @@ bool enableFastBgScrub();
bool mnfgSpareDramDeploy();
/**
- * @brief Returns the state of the MNFG_IPL_MEMORY_CE_CHECKINGE policy flag.
- * @return TRUE if MNFG_IPL_MEMORY_CE_CHECKINGE is set, FALSE otherwise.
+ * @brief Returns the state of the MNFG_IPL_MEMORY_CE_CHECKING policy flag.
+ * @return TRUE if MNFG_IPL_MEMORY_CE_CHECKING is set, FALSE otherwise.
*/
bool isMfgCeCheckingEnabled();
OpenPOWER on IntegriCloud